Bear in mind that if you're with BT (and most other ADSL providers) they give you a USB ADSL modem by standard. This means that to use a router for sharing the connection you either need to enable Microsoft Internet Connection Sharing on one PC (meaning that PC has to be on all the time to allow other PC's to access the 'Net), or upgrade to an ethernet capable ADSL modem such as the Eicon 2430SE (which I use).
